Native Deen – Small Deeds 4k
Native Deen’s first music video restored in 4k. From the album “Deen You Know, filmed in 2005. Small Deeds [LYRICS] Ever...
Check out all of Native Deen’s new music videos from their albums and also individual member’s solo projects.